En ce qui concerne mes deux fichier schema.yml tout fonctionne bien.
En faite pour pallier le probleme de construction propel et du d'après
les divers galères que j'ai pu avoir et d'avoir d'un coté un
fichier .xml et de l'autre un fichier yml. Donc j'ai du convertir mon
fichier xml en fichier yml et tout fonctionne.
C'est pour cela qu'il me semble qu'il faut créeer une passerelle entre
les deux schémas.
Et d'après ce que j'ai compris les la table sf_guard_User_Profile sert
a ça.
C'est vrai que c'est bizarre d'avoir deux tables utilisateurs J'ai
commencé mon projet avec une table utilisateur, donc je ne peu pas
trop trop changer.
Cette méthode et pas pratique mais si quelqu'un en as une meilleur je
prend.
Pour mon problème je crois que je vais changer et de mettre ma table
utilisateur dans sf_guard_user_profile.
On 29 nov, 00:43, "lionel chanson" <[EMAIL PROTECTED]> wrote:
> Bonsoir,
>
> Apparement ce plugin fournit son propre fichier schema.yml. Dans
> d'autres posts cela a posé problème également, et de souvenir il y
> avait un problème d'ordre d'appel des 2 fichiers schema.yml.
> Pourquoi ne pas copier les infos du schema.yml du plugin dans le
> schema.yml du projet symfony ?
>
> Sinon écrit tout en minuscule ( util_id type ). Mais ce qui est
> bizarre c'est que tu as 2 tables utilisateurs, sf_guard_user et
> utilisateur.
>
> ++
>
> Le 28/11/07, mugen<[EMAIL PROTECTED]> a écrit :
>
>
>
> > Bonjour,
>
> > Un petit probleme de conception, je galère pour l'implémentation du
> > profile avec le plugin sfGuard. J'ai creer une table profile qui
> > permet de me faire la passerelle entre mon schema.yml et celui du
> > plugin. Mais ca ne fonctionne pas.
>
> > Dans mon schema.yml je met la table
> > sf_guard_user_profile:
> > _attributes: { phpName: sfGuardUserProfile }
> > id:
> > user_id: { type: integer, foreignTable: sf_guard_user,
> > foreignReference: id, required: true, onDelete: cascade }
> > util_id: { type: INTEGER, foreignTable: utilisateur,
> > foreignReference: id }
>
> > Cette table met en relation la table sfGuardUser et ma table
> > utilisateur mais elle ne fonctionne pas.
>
> > Avez vous une idée de la façon dont il faut procédé pour pallier ce
> > probleme ?
--~--~---------~--~----~------------~-------~--~----~
Vous avez reçu ce message, car vous êtes abonné au groupe Groupe "Symfony-fr"
de Google Groupes.
Pour transmettre des messages à ce groupe, envoyez un e-mail à
l'adresse [email protected]
Pour résilier votre abonnement à ce groupe, envoyez un e-mail à
l'adresse [EMAIL PROTECTED]
Pour afficher d'autres options, visitez ce groupe à l'adresse
http://groups.google.com/group/symfony-fr?hl=fr
-~----------~----~----~----~------~----~------~--~---